史宾格怎么样
作为一个技术博主,我经常受到读者的询问,其中一个常见的问题就是史宾格怎么样。作为一名使用史宾格的长期用户,我很乐意分享一些关于史宾格的经验和观点。
什么是史宾格?
史宾格是一种流行的前端开发框架,由Twitter开发并于2010年首次发布。它使用和CSS构建用户界面,采用了组件化的思想,使开发人员能够轻松地构建交互性强的Web应用程序。
史宾格的主要优势在于其简洁性和可复用性。通过将用户界面分解为独立的组件,开发人员可以更好地组织和管理代码,提高代码的可读性和可维护性。此外,史宾格还提供了一套强大的工具和库,帮助开发人员更高效地构建应用程序。
史宾格的特点
- 响应式设计:史宾格的组件可以根据不同的屏幕尺寸自适应布局,提供更好的用户体验。
- 虚拟DOM:史宾格使用虚拟DOM技术,只重新渲染需要变化的部分,提高了性能。
- 单向数据流:史宾格采用了单向数据流的架构,使数据的流动更加可控,减少了不必要的复杂性。
- 组件化开发:史宾格鼓励开发人员将界面划分为独立的组件,可复用性更强,减少了重复代码的编写。
- 大型应用支持:史宾格的架构设计使其非常适合构建大型应用程序,能够有效地管理和组织复杂的代码。
如何开始使用史宾格?
如果您对史宾格感兴趣,并且想开始使用它来开发自己的应用程序,下面是一些简单的步骤:
- 安装史宾格:
<script src="ivr.net/npm/vue@2.6.12/dist/vue.min.js"></script>
- 创建一个 HTML 元素作为史宾格应用程序的容器:
<div id="app"></div>
- 编写史宾格组件:
<script> Vue.component('hello-world', { template: '<p>Hello World!</p>' }); </script>
- 实例化史宾格应用程序:
<script> new Vue({ el: '#app' }); </script>
- 在 HTML 中使用史宾格组件:
<hello-world></hello-world>
通过按照上述步骤进行,您可以很快地开始使用史宾格来开发您的第一个应用程序。当然,这只是一个简单的示例,史宾格还提供了许多其他功能和选项,可以根据您的需求进行配置和定制。
为什么选择史宾格?
作为一名经验丰富的开发人员,我选择史宾格作为我的主要前端框架有以下几个原因:
- 易于上手:史宾格的语法简洁明了,学习曲线较为平缓,即使是新手也能够很快上手。
- 活跃的社区支持:史宾格拥有一个庞大而活跃的开发社区,您可以轻松找到解决问题的答案和分享经验的机会。
- 丰富的生态系统:史宾格有许多强大的插件和库,可以帮助您快速解决常见的开发问题。
- 良好的文档和教程:史宾格提供了详细的文档和教程,让您可以轻松地学习和使用各种功能。
- 可靠性和稳定性:史宾格经过了长期的发展和测试,已经被广泛用于生产环境,并且具有良好的稳定性和可靠性。
总而言之,史宾格是一种强大且灵活的前端开发框架,适用于各种规模的应用程序开发。无论您是一个初学者还是一个经验丰富的开发人员,史宾格都可以帮助您构建高质量的Web应用程序。
希望本文对您了解史宾格有所帮助。如果您对史宾格有任何进一步的问题或意见,请随时在下方评论区留言。谢谢阅读!
- 相关评论
- 我要评论
-